Transaction 95ec68671d117422b1026de658183e0922228203d44bd41a193b32900362bea8

1 Input
2 Outputs
  • 95ec68671d117422b1026de658183e0922228203d44bd41a193b32900362bea8:0
  • value  3101
    address  1KwRfGnVEChrUbxnrBQKbryn6o1VBZi8JC
  • 95ec68671d117422b1026de658183e0922228203d44bd41a193b32900362bea8:1
  • value  2206489
    address  1DZNRZf8PWw2uDgptLri86SwMQtKyrZt6T